2017-02-27 2 views
-2

아약스 호출을 통해 얻은 일부 JSON 데이터에 액세스하려고합니다. 지금이 데이터에 액세스하는 방법을 잘 모르겠습니다. json에서 "테스트"부분을 추출하고 싶습니다. 사람이이 JSON 데이터에 액세스하려면 어떻게해야합니까?

Image of current output

코드 샘플 좀 도와 주 시겠어요 :

$(".test").on("click", function() { 
var dialogID = $(this).attr("id"); 
console.log(dialogID); 
$.ajax({ 
    type: "GET", 
    url: "test.php?id=" + dialogID, 
    dataType: "json", 
    success: function(data) { 
    console.log(data); 
    }, 
    error: function() { 
    console.log("error"); 
    } 
}); 
+4

무슨이 길이 1의 배열 있음을 알려줍니다에 너 지금까지 해봤 니? –

+2

여기에 코드를 표시해야합니다. 이미지 란 우리가 손으로 직접 보여주는 작은 코드를 입력하도록 강요한다는 것을 의미합니다. 그 일을 우리를 위해하십시오. – Rob

답변

2

라는 변수에 저장되어있는 아약스 데이터를 가정 '데이터'

data['DATA'][0][0]; 

당신이 보는 경우 개발자 콘솔에서 인덱스 0에있는 배열의 항목에서 '테스트'를 알게됩니다.이 배열은 DATA라는 다른 배열의 인덱스 0에 있습니다. DATA는 AJAX 호출에 의해 반환 된 객체의 배열입니다.

옆 개발자 콘솔에있는 변수 이름에 대한 모든 데이터 유형을 볼 수있는, 즉 '열 : 배열 [1]'두 번째 줄은 열

+0

이것은 효과가 있습니다. 고마워, 선생님! – djacobsen13

+0

다행스럽게 도울 수있었습니다! –

관련 문제